The Drafthollow diagram editor exposes undo and redo through the history endpoint. Each mutation is recorded as a reversible operation; the stack depth is configurable per workspace and defaults to two hundred entries. Redo history is cleared on any new mutation. Release builds must verify history replay against the staging service, which requires the internal key shown below.

gateway credential: kto3_qfe

Management Meeting Minutes — For the Board

Attendees: exec team. Topic: churn in the Skylark pilot.

Churn at 14% month-on-month, above the 8% threshold. Main driver: onboarding friction. Actions: revised setup flow by month-end; retention offers for at-risk accounts. Pilot continuation decision deferred. Strategic implications are covered in the note below.

board note of bawep-tajef: Queniusek Systems plans to raise the Quenvan list price by 53.1 percent in March. The pricing group signed off on a budget of $176.4 million for Project Drueth. The renewal with Casionix Partners closes at $142.5 million a year, 8.3 percent below the last contract. Project Fraax slips by six weeks because of the tooling delay.

## Step 4: Retrying failed exports

Once you've migrated to the Fernhollow export pipeline, failed jobs land in the retry queue instead of dying quietly — nice upgrade from the old setup. Retries use exponential backoff and give up after the cap, at which point the job moves to the dead-letter bucket for manual review. Don't tweak the backoff by hand; it's all config-driven. The relevant settings are shown below.

service settings:
[casax]
port = 6379
team = rusir
host = casax.zemvarhq.corp
region = outer-4
access_code = ac_9808ce
timeout_ms = 1500

### Step 3: Warm-path packaging

Cold starts on the Quillrun platform exceed 900 ms if your handler bundles unused deps. Prune them. Use the slim runtime image. Pre-initialize clients outside the handler body. Verify with the cold-start probe before submitting. When the probe passes, sign your plugin archive with the key that follows.

rollout seal: bky4_x7Gc

- [ ] Step 7: Archive cold storage buckets (Glacierline tier). Confirm both ceremony witnesses are present, verify bucket manifests match the Oxbow ledger, then seal the archive key shares. Plugin authors may observe but not handle shares. Once sealed, the archive index itself is encrypted and can only be reopened with the passphrase below.

vault phrase of badup-hahig = tamael-aldael-kelmir-istael-fenok-istwyn-tamius-jorath-oliion